Evolvability in the context of antibiotic resistance

Timo van Eldijk

Abstract: GlossaryBiological system: We here define a biological system to be any biological entity that can be subject to evolution by natural selection. Cryptic genetic variation:Standing genetic variation that has little effect on phenotypic variation under normal conditions, but generates variation under changed conditions. The release of this variation can facilitate (or hamper) adaptation and thus impact evolvability.
